2012-06-14 102 views
1

除了使用軟件包管理器控制檯以外,是否有任何方法安裝C#庫?我想使用Facebook C# SDK,但我使用的是Visual Studio Express for WP,而我沒有PMC。我發現this guide on nuget,但我將不得不以其他方式做。在沒有軟件包管理器控制檯的情況下安裝C#庫

任何想法?

+0

通過安裝它們,您的意思是將庫添加到GAC? –

+0

我想將庫添加到當前項目中,以便我可以使用它。 – networkprofile

+0

您是使用VS2012 express還是2010 express? –

回答

3

它在README.md文件中提到了如何下載Facebook C#SDK .dll文件,而不使用NuGet包管理器控制檯在https://github.com/facebook-csharp-sdk/facebook-csharp-sdk

二進制爲Facebook C#SDK僅通過的NuGet分佈。對於那些不支持NuGet Package Manager的舊版Visual Studio,請下載命令行版本的NuGet.exe(http://nuget.codeplex.com/releases/view/58939)並運行以下命令。

nuget install Facebook 

如果您想獲取舊版本的二進制文件,請使用以下命令。

nuget install Facebook -v 5.4.1 

更新: 呦可以從瀏覽器直接導航到http://nuget.org/api/v2/package/Facebook/6.4.0重命名.nupkg爲.zip並使用您喜歡的壓縮程序解壓下載的版本。

3

還有另一種開源的IDE sharpDevelop。 它可以將包添加到您的項目。 它適用於Visual Studio文件!

在最新版本中,插件甚至與獨立於Visual Studio插件的插件無關! Nuget in SharpDevelop

PS:它與VS的插件相比有一些限制,複雜的軟件包將無法完成他們應該做的所有事情。與IDE的交互可能會失敗。 (因此,如果您使用SharpDevelop安裝該軟件包,則MVC 3模型生成將不起作用)

0

VS 2012具有Tools-> Library Package Manager下的選項。

+0

請記住,這是一個RC版本。 –

0

您可以獲得Facebook SDK source from github並從解決方案中添加對sdk項目的引用。

或者只是從Facebook SDK解決方案構建庫並將它們引用到您的項目中。

相關問題